Job Summary

Supervises employees in the construction, operation and maintenance of electric and/or gas distribution and transmission systems. Oversees, plans and schedules new construction work, preventive and corrective maintenance, inspections and training activities. Ensures that construction and maintenance is completed in accordance with construction standards, following approved policies, procedures, safety rules and budgets. May interact with customers (internal & external) to solve problems/concerns and ensure customer satisfaction.


Key Responsibilities

Plans and oversees work of line and gas and/or electric departments. Supervises to ensure safe and efficient operation of the daily field activities of both Company and various contractor construction crews. May resolve customer issues when needed. May provide assistance to Technical Services on new construction and rebuilding existing plants. Works closely with the PSC and local government agencies. (50%,P)
Schedules the work of line or street crews. Assess the scope of projects and assigns the appropriate crew and skills balance. Arranges for any special equipment and insures that all material needs are met. (20%,P)
Administers damage claims and billing, leak reports, time sheets, store orders, job kitting, work order balancing, material review, compliance with safety rules and regulations, standards of excellence and/or service guarantees. Monitors accuracy of Gas Records for auditing purposes and ensure compliance. (10%,P)
Oversees construction office and support budget management. May coordinate department activities with local and state highway departmental officials. (10%,S)
Supervises emergency restoration. (5%,S)
Coordinates safety training, documentation, inspections, and accident investigations. May be responsible for labor relations contract administration and communications. May conduct employee evaluations for annual performance appraisal process. (5%,S)
